Dubai’s Parkin Company, the largest provider of public parking facilities, has announced a strategic partnership with Skyports Infrastructure, a global leader in vertiport infrastructure development. This collaboration is aimed at managing parking facilities for Dubai’s future air taxi network, which is expected to revolutionize the city’s transportation system.
Under the agreement, Parkin and Skyports will work together to provide parking facilities at vertiport locations, the sites where air taxis will take off and land. Additionally, both companies will explore opportunities to develop new infrastructure across Parkin’s extensive network to support the growth of air taxi services.

Skyports’ Role in Dubai’s Air Taxi Future
Duncan Walker, CEO of Skyports Infrastructure, emphasized the complementary nature of the partnership. “Our collaboration with Parkin combines our expertise in vertiport infrastructure with Parkin’s extensive network of facilities. This will enable us to expand vertiport infrastructure throughout the city and accelerate the adoption of air taxi services,” Walker said.
Earlier in February 2024, Skyports signed an agreement with Dubai’s Road and Transport Authority (RTA) and Joby Aviation, a manufacturer of all-electric aircraft, to launch passenger air taxi services in the city by 2026. This agreement granted Skyports the exclusive rights to develop and operate vertiports in Dubai.
Supporting Dubai’s Green Mobility and Autonomous Transport Goals
The air taxi project is a key component of Dubai’s Green Mobility Strategy and Smart Autonomous Mobility Strategy 2030. It aims to establish the emirate as the first location with a commercial, city-wide electric air taxi service. The new transport system will offer a sustainable alternative to traditional transportation, significantly reducing traffic congestion and emissions.
Parkin’s long-term agreement with the RTA, which grants the company exclusive rights to operate and manage paid public parking services across Dubai for the next 49 years, underscores its central role in the city’s evolving transportation landscape.
